Transaction 3223bc4f161787f51afbf64bc567f253543a055bc571170348a0b28da257058a
1 Input
1 Output
-
3223bc4f161787f51afbf64bc567f253543a055bc571170348a0b28da257058a:0
- value
- 21979459
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d2892f69a703ba596d4d2118d6cdf10dd4ea05c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DsNtBgszQCPanqG3SDmULwq4urPDRoVEC